Week 4 - The Three Billy Goats Gruff

Traditional Tales - The Three Billy Goats Gruff

This week we read 'The three Billy Goats Gruff', then we had a go at writing a sentence describing the troll. In Forest School we made bridges just like in the story.

In Maths we have been thinking about number bonds to 10 using a ten dice frame, our fingers and using counters. We have found this quite tricky and might be something we want to practice at home. The children can use their fingers to help them work the bond out, or explain how they know they are correct.

In Religious Education we have been think of the special gift of joy and peace that Jesus gave to the disciples and that he gives to us.

We have noticed that some of the children are going backwards in their reading, this is very concerning - we are trying to give them extra opportunities to read at school but please ensure you read at home daily. There are new tricky words to learn, so make sure you  are checking google classroom and again practising every night.

Our caterpillars have all transformed now, they are in the chrysalis stage. We are looking forward to the exciting butterfly stage!
